Ticket #4471 — Signature check failing on WhisperHall audio-guide builds

So the gallery tablets started rejecting yesterday's bundle with a bad-signature error, even though CI was green. Turns out the packaging step picked up the retired 2022 key from a stale cache on the build runner. Fix: purge the runner cache and re-sign. For anyone hitting this later — always confirm the fingerprint matches the vault entry before shipping. Re-sign the bundle using the current release key below.

deploy key for kajof-fajop: bky6_gDHw9Q

**14:22** — Meridel calendar sync began double-writing events after the Skylark connector retried a stale cursor. Conflict resolver picked the older revision, clobbering ~300 attendee updates. **14:31** — paged. **14:40** — connector paused, cursor reset from snapshot. **14:55** — replayed updates from the journal; spot checks clean. **15:10** — sync resumed, conflict rate nominal. Follow-up: add cursor staleness check before retry. The offending deploy is identified by the token below.

build token for kagaf-hahof: htk14_9d3d4d26d7d8de

**Vendor note: Inkmill markdown pipeline**

Rendering for Parchway docs is outsourced to Inkmill under an annual contract, renewing each March. They handle sanitization and PDF export; we own the upload queue. SLA: 4-hour response on rendering failures. Escalate only after two failed retries. Their support desk is reachable at the address below.

billing contact of hahaf-baguf = zorael.tammir.jorius@sivrelhq.internal

Hey team — handover from Marta before I head to the Lindqvist office.

The RateMirror parity checker now scans partner hotel rates every two hours instead of daily, so expect more mismatch tickets. Most "parity violations" are just currency rounding; the checker flags anything over 0.5%. If a hotel disputes a flag, rerun the single-property scan before replying. Don't touch the scheduler config without pinging Joao first. Everything you need, including the rerun button, is on this internal page:

runbook for tafof-yawif: https://confluence.tolvaqsys.internal/display/display/browse/pages/7be3